Crafternoon Tea
Every Tuesday, 1pm - 3.30pm
Crafternoon Tea session are held every Tuesday at the John Mansfield Centre. Anyone with a physical disability are welcome to come along and either bring their own crafts or learn a new craft idea. Tea and cakes will be provided along with good company.
